Price for Carbides, Whether or Not Chemically Defined in Latvia (CIF) - 2022
The average import price for carbides, whether or not chemically defineds stood at $6,654 per ton in 2022, jumping by 21% against the previous year. In general, the import price posted a buoyant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when the average import price increased by 148% against the previous year. Over the period under review, average import prices reached the maximum in 2022 and is expected to retain growth in years to come.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the UK ($8,381 per ton), while the price for Estonia ($1,500 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Russia (+21.5%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Price for Carbides, Whether or Not Chemically Defined in Latvia (FOB) - 2022
The average export price for carbides, whether or not chemically defineds stood at $4,426 per ton in 2022, standing approx. at the previous year. Overall, the export price showed a drastic downturn.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2013 an increase of 98% against the previous year.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$25,662 per ton. From 2014 to 2022, the average export prices remained at a lower figure.
As there is only one major export destination, the average price level is determined by prices for Russia.
From 2012 to 2022, the rate of growth in terms of prices for Russia amounted to -12.3% per year.
Imports of Carbides, Whether or Not Chemically Defined in Latvia
In 2022, approx. 4.1 tons of carbides, whether or not chemically defineds were imported into Latvia; waning by -54.2% against the year before. In general, imports continue to indicate a sharp reduction. The smallest decline of -38.1% was in 2020.
In value terms, imports of carbides, whether or not chemically defineds fell dramatically to $27K in 2022. Overall, imports continue to indicate a significant curtailment. The smallest decline of -11.9% was in 2021.
